

Chin Lay, 84, of Chicago passed away peacefully on September 26, 2025. She was born in Kampot, Cambodia to the late Wu Eam Gang, and Tang Gim Sieu on June 15, 1941. She was married to Lay Heng Hak who passed away in 1977. She came to the United States with her five young children in September 1979 as refugees. Her resilience and strength carried her and her children through one of the most difficult transitions of their lives, and she continued to persevere for the sake of her family. She dedicated her entire life to taking care of her children and never remarried because she said no other men were as good as her husband and that she only loved him.
She had a passion for gardening, traveling, cooking, spending time with family & friends, and sharing stories of her life. She was admired for her green thumb and could grow anything regardless of the season. She is survived by her children Josephine, Henry (and Terri), Kevin (and Moy), Lee (and Jennifer), and Peter (and Ying Huang), and her grandchildren Brandon, Connie, Eric, Amanda, Kaylin, Megan, Grace, and Sarah.
